fix(KB-165): resolve planning modal autostart in StrictMode
- Fix double-render bug by using ref for hasAutoStarted instead of state\n- Enable auto-start planning tests in App.test.tsx and ListView.test.tsx\n- Add changeset for the planning modal autostart fix\n- Add comprehensive tests for planning mode auto-start behavior
